Obituary for Raymond A Wilson

Raymond A. Wilson, 64, of Jersey City, entered eternal life on April, 19, 2020. Raymond was a lifelong resident of Jersey City and worked for Hartz Mountain Industries. He was a senior Field Supervisor, from 1987 until the time of his passing. Raymond was the loving father of Raymond (RJ) and his wife Rose, his son Brian and his wife Kelly. He was the cherished grandfather to Ryan, Justin, Maximus, Justine and her husband Michael. His great grandsons Luke and Aiden. His sister Theresa Miller and his longtime girlfriend Patricia Janssen. Ray is also survived by his nephews and niece and was predeceased by his father Raymond H. Wilson, his mother Rose Rita Bonaventura and his brother Steve Wilson. Raymond loved sports, especially football, where his favorite team was the Vikings. He was a big Star Trek fan who’s favorite saying was “Live Long and Prosper.”. He was a lifelong coach, starting with his sons and ending with his grandsons. He was their #1 fan and cheered them on through losses and wins. He loved going to his favorite restaurant La Reggia, in Secaucus with his longtime girlfriend Patty, where they enjoyed dinner, drinks and music.
